The planet's global temperature remains very high, and meteorological data show that last year was the third warmest on record, with 2023 and 2024 setting record highs.
The year 2025 was the third warmest on record and the third consecutive year in which temperatures remained above the 1.5°C limit, a European scientific centre said today.
Data indicate that 2025 ranked among the three warmest years in the historical record, continuing the trend of rising global temperatures.

Climate change, exacerbated by human behaviour, made 2025 one of the three warmest years on record, according to scientists.
